2. Charles Xavier’s Wheelchair Cost
He is finally bald. And he is finally sitting on the same wheelchair as Patrick Stewart’s Xavier did. Well, not literally. The original wheelchair used in the very first X-Men movie is now being auctioned. The bid will start from $60,000.
Even though it is the exact same wheelchair, it does not mean that you can move it around without touching it. Xavier has a telepathic power, remember?
The wheelchair works like a normal wheelchair. Since you don’t have any mutant power, you need to use a joystick on the front part of the right side arm pad to move.
Similar wheelchair is mass-manufactured in Japan. It is the WHILL Type-A Electric Wheelchair. One unit of this luxurious wheelchair is sold for $9,500.
